So I went to this old warehouse, downtown chicago, near west side, that's now a recording studio, and part has an electronics shop with spare everything on shelves everywhere. Just loaded with tubes, tranny's computers, and electronics/ music equipment. So I brought in 4 Mesa STR 420's and 4 Mesa STR 440's to test. the guy showed me how to use the tester so... The 420's came out of my 2:90 that were from 1994, and I used it a lot but I guess not as much as I thought. they still tested almost 90%. crazy. the 440's came out of a IIC that i got last summer, and were thought to be dead, but they also tested out at about 90%. all 8 12ax7's were used up... testing at about 65%. I guess it shouldn't be much of a surprise now that I'm writing this since I did use the A channel more. duh. I did use the B side too, and I just randomly grabbed 4 out of the 8 I had on my shelf ignoring the one that was definitely spent. I'll have to test the other 4.

So I was talking to the guy that own's the shop, and asking him about tubes, and he pulls out a matched quad of green labeled Mesa STR-415's. so he goes over to look for them and he is digging for them and I hear tubes smashing on the ground. he's like fu@k!...etc etc. i thought the 415's were destroyed, but they were fine. I asked him how much, and he said $125. ok, um yeah, I'll take them. I also got 2 RCA long black plate 12ax7's for $15 each and another RCA 12ax7a for $15.

so now i'm excited to have a surplus of output tubes now. I also just got 3 pairs of nos sylvania 6L6gc for cheap.
